Abstract

The application provides a radar signal sorting method and device, electronic equipment and storage medium, and relates to the technical field of radar signal processing. The method comprises the following steps: sorting a to-be-sorted pulse sequence to obtain a plurality of clusters, and obtaining a sorting number of each pulse descriptor word in the to-be-sorted pulse sequence; determining that the to-be-sorted pulse sequence is a pulse sequence other than a pulse sequence of a reference beat in a plurality of beat pulse sequences, inputting the to-be-sorted pulse sequence into a tracking model, and obtaining a tracking number of each pulse descriptor word in the to-be-sorted pulse sequence output by the tracking model; and correcting the sorting number of each pulse descriptor word in the to-be-sorted pulse sequence based on the tracking number of each pulse descriptor word in the to-be-sorted pulse sequence. The tracking model is trained based on a pulse sequence of a reference beat and a corresponding sorting number label. The application can improve the sorting accuracy of radar signals and improve the sorting efficiency of radar signals.

[0045] With the rapid development of technology, applications of radar signal-based identification are becoming increasingly widespread, such as target identification, target tracking, and target localization. However, due to the rapid advancement of radar technology, the operating frequency coverage of radars is wider, signal parameters are more agile, and the reconnaissance coverage is broader. This leads to aliasing of received multi-source signals, meaning that the radar receiver receives mostly pulse data from multiple target radars. To better identify radar signals, it is necessary to sort the radar signals.

[0046] Traditional sorting methods based on PDW (Pulse Describe Words) data such as signal carrier frequency, pulse width, angle of arrival, and pulse repetition period are difficult to effectively sort radar radiation source signals with multiple sources overlapping.

[0047] Currently, radar signal sorting is performed using a radar signal sorting algorithm based on the PRI (Pulse Repeat Interval) histogram. Specifically, for received pulse data, a pulse arrival time sequence within a certain range is extracted, and the TOA (Time of Arrival) difference between any two pulses is calculated. This difference is used to estimate the possible PRI patterns of the pulse data through statistical analysis, thereby performing sequence retrieval for the PRI. More specifically, firstly, pulses received within a certain period are extracted, the TOA difference between any two pulses is calculated, the difference is statistically analyzed, and a histogram is plotted. Secondly, the difference with the most frequent occurrences is identified as the possible PRI value, which is used as a parameter of the radar signal for sequence retrieval. If several PRI values ​​are close, the smallest PRI value is selected for sequence retrieval. If the sequence retrieval is successful, this PRI value is recorded, and the PRI variation pattern is re-estimated based on the retrieved sequence. If the retrieval fails, other larger PRI values ​​are used to continue the retrieval. Finally, the successfully retrieved sequences are removed, and the above steps are repeated for the remaining pulses until sorting is complete. However, radar signal sorting algorithms based on PRI histograms require calculating a large number of differences, leading to reduced sorting efficiency. Furthermore, the sorting accuracy is low when dealing with complex radar signals. Even when improving the algorithm using pulse sequence correlation—that is, calculating only the TOA difference between adjacent pulses for each retrieval to accumulate the difference and reduce computation—the computational load remains high. Moreover, the sorting performance deteriorates under complex radar PRI modulation patterns (e.g., jitter PRI, slip PRI, etc.) and high noise interference conditions, thus reducing the sorting accuracy.

[0064] Considering that in the radar signal sorting process, after the pulse sequences of each beat are sorted independently, the sorting results between beats are not correlated. Therefore, a tracking model is trained using the pulse sequence of a reference beat, and the pulse sequences of other beats are input into the tracking model to obtain the tracking number of each pulse descriptor. Then, based on the tracking number of each pulse descriptor, the sorting number of each pulse descriptor is corrected. This ensures that for the pulse descriptor of the same radar target, its sorting number should remain consistent in the sorting results of multiple beats. That is, the radar signal is stably tracked between beats, ensuring that the sorting results between beats are correlated. Ultimately, this improves the stability and accuracy of radar signal sorting.

[0070] Based on the above embodiments, Figure 2 This is a second flowchart illustrating the radar signal sorting method provided by the present invention, as shown below. Figure 2 As shown, step 130 above includes:

[0071] Step 131: Based on the tracking number of each pulse descriptor in each cluster, determine the number of target tracking numbers in each cluster, wherein any target tracking number is the tracking number with the largest number in the cluster.

[0072] For any given cluster, count the tracking numbers of each pulse descriptor in that cluster, and determine the number of tracking numbers that are most numerous in that cluster.

[0073] Step 132: Based on the number of each number and the number of pulse descriptors of each cluster, determine the tracking threshold of each cluster. The tracking threshold of any cluster is determined based on the ratio of the number of numbers of the cluster to the number of pulse descriptors of the cluster.

[0074] For any cluster, the tracking threshold for that cluster is determined based on the ratio of the number of target tracking IDs to the number of pulse descriptors in that cluster. This ratio can be used directly as the tracking threshold, or it can be obtained through further data processing. The number of pulse descriptors is the total number of pulse descriptors in the cluster.

[0075] Step 133: Determine the first target cluster whose tracking threshold is greater than the preset tracking threshold, and correct the sorting number of each pulse descriptor in the first target cluster to the target tracking number of the first target cluster.

[0076] Here, the preset tracking threshold is a pre-set threshold, preferably 0.9.

[0077] Here, the number of first target clusters can be one or more, and the first target cluster is a cluster among multiple clusters. That is, multiple clusters may include one or more first target clusters. Of course, multiple clusters may not include the first target clusters.

[0078] For any first target cluster, the sorting number of each pulse descriptor in the first target cluster is corrected to the target tracking number with the largest number in the first target cluster.

[0079] For example, a certain cluster has a sorting number of 2 and a pulse descriptor number of 500. The tracking number of the pulse descriptor can include 1-7. The tracking number of 480 pulse descriptors in this cluster is 5, that is, the target tracking number of this cluster is 5. Based on this, the tracking threshold of this cluster is 0.96. If the preset tracking threshold is 0.9, then the tracking threshold of 0.96 is greater than the preset tracking threshold of 0.9. Therefore, the sorting number 2 of each pulse descriptor in this cluster is corrected to the target tracking number 5, which is the most numerous in this cluster.

[0083] Based on any of the above embodiments, after step 132, the method further includes:

[0084] A second target cluster is determined where the tracking threshold is less than or equal to a preset tracking threshold, and the sorting number of each pulse descriptor in the second target cluster is incremented by a preset value.

[0085] Here, the number of second target clusters can be one or more, and the second target cluster is a cluster among multiple clusters. That is, the multiple clusters may include one or more first target clusters. Of course, the multiple clusters may not include the second target cluster.

[0086] For any second target cluster, the sorting number of each pulse descriptor in the second target cluster is corrected to the sum of each sorting number and a preset value. The preset value should be greater than or equal to the largest sorting number, so that the sorting number corrected by adding the preset value can distinguish the sorting number obtained from sorting. Preferably, the preset value can be 100.

[0087] For example, a certain cluster has a sorting number of 2 and a pulse descriptor number of 500. The tracking number of the pulse descriptor can include 1-7. The tracking number of 440 pulse descriptors in this cluster is 5, that is, the target tracking number of this cluster is 5. Based on this, the tracking threshold of this cluster is 0.88. If the preset tracking threshold is 0.9, then the tracking threshold of 0.88 is less than the preset tracking threshold of 0.9. Let the preset value be 100, then the sorting number 2 of each pulse descriptor in this cluster is corrected to 102.

[0088] The radar signal sorting method provided in this embodiment of the invention performs a preset value increment on the sorting number of each pulse descriptor in the second target cluster whose tracking threshold is less than or equal to a preset tracking threshold. This distinguishes the sorting number from the previously obtained sorting pulse sequence, thereby separating the pulse descriptors with tracking abnormalities and improving the sorting accuracy of radar signals.

[0089] Based on any of the above embodiments, in this method, step 110 includes:

[0090] Blind clustering is performed on the pulse sequences to be sorted to obtain multiple clusters.

[0091] The multiple clusters are numbered respectively to obtain the sorting number of each pulse descriptor in the pulse sequence to be sorted.

[0092] Specifically, blind clustering (blind sorting) is performed on each pulse descriptor in the pulse sequence to be sorted, resulting in multiple clusters. Each cluster corresponds to a sorting number.

[0093] In one embodiment, after comparing various clustering algorithms, DBSCAN (Density-Based Spatial Clustering of Applications with Noise) is used to perform blind clustering of the pulse sequence to be sorted, thus eliminating the need to specify the number of categories. This algorithm has a fast clustering speed, thereby improving the sorting efficiency of radar signals. Furthermore, this algorithm can effectively handle noise points and discover spatial clusters of arbitrary shapes, thereby improving the sorting accuracy of radar signals and ultimately meeting the requirements of radar signal sorting scenarios.

[0094] The radar signal sorting method provided in this embodiment of the invention performs blind clustering processing on the pulse sequence to be sorted, thereby eliminating the need to specify the number of categories, thus improving the clustering speed and improving the sorting efficiency of radar signals; and the blind clustering processing does not require training data, thereby improving the convenience of radar signal sorting.

[0107] Considering that the model identification model is trained based on pulse sequences of N types of radars, and the trained model is an N-classification model, while the pulse sequences to be sorted may include signals other than those N types of radars, it is designed for an open-set scenario. The test data can include data corresponding to radar models other than the training data. Therefore, it is necessary to determine the confidence level of each model identification result so that the target model identification results with confidence levels less than or equal to the preset confidence threshold are updated to the out-of-set data identification results.

[0108] In one embodiment, considering that the pulse sequence includes PDW, after comparing various neural networks and traditional machine learning classification algorithms, the model identification model can select an SVM classifier to improve the accuracy of model identification.

[0109] The radar signal sorting method provided in this embodiment of the invention determines the confidence level corresponding to each model identification result, so as to update the target model identification result with a confidence level less than or equal to a preset confidence threshold to the out-of-set data identification result, thereby preventing the signal of other radar models that do not belong to the N models in the set of data from being identified as any of the N models, thereby improving the accuracy of radar model identification.

[0136] To facilitate understanding of the technical effects of the above embodiments, the above embodiments are evaluated using indicators such as sorting accuracy, sorting batch increase rate, sorting incorrect batch rate, model recognition accuracy, and signal tracking stability. The above embodiments show improved overall performance in terms of these five indicators and are more timely. Among them, the sorting accuracy rate is the ratio of the correctly sorted result to all sorted results; the sorting batching rate is the ratio of the batched result to all sorted results, where a pulse emitted by a radar individual is batched into two numbers; the sorting mis-batching rate is the ratio of the mis-batching result to all sorted results, where pulses emitted from different radar individuals are batched into the same number, i.e., sorting fails; the model identification accuracy rate is the ratio of the successfully identified result to all model identification results, where successful identification means that in a sorting cycle, if the sorted signal i is correctly sorted and corresponds to target j, and the model identification result of signal i is the model label corresponding to target j, then target j is considered successfully identified; signal tracking stability refers to the fact that in the signal sorting process, after each cycle performs sorting independently, the sorting results between cycles need to be correlated. The number of the signal corresponding to a certain target should remain consistent throughout the entire sorting task, i.e., the signal is stably tracked between cycles.
